What are the tips for Kraken Futures Trading?

To succeed on Kraken Futures, understand the market, set clear goals, manage risk, use leverage wisely, and continuously learn and adapt your strategies.

Apr 06, 2025 at 09:22 pm

Kraken Futures is a popular platform for trading cryptocurrency futures. To maximize your success on this platform, it's essential to understand and implement various trading strategies and tips. This article will delve into key tips for Kraken Futures trading, covering aspects such as understanding the market, managing risk, and utilizing the platform's features effectively.

Understanding the Market

Before diving into Kraken Futures trading, it's crucial to have a solid understanding of the cryptocurrency market. This includes staying updated on market trends, news, and events that could impact cryptocurrency prices. Familiarize yourself with the different types of futures contracts available on Kraken, such as perpetual futures and quarterly futures. Each type has its own characteristics and risks, so understanding these can help you make informed trading decisions.

Setting Clear Goals

Establishing clear trading goals is essential for success in Kraken Futures trading. Determine what you aim to achieve, whether it's short-term gains or long-term investment. Set realistic profit targets and risk tolerance levels. Having clear goals will help you stay focused and disciplined in your trading approach. It's also important to regularly review and adjust your goals based on your trading performance and market conditions.

Risk Management

Effective risk management is a cornerstone of successful futures trading. One of the key tips for Kraken Futures trading is to never risk more than you can afford to lose. Use stop-loss orders to limit potential losses on your trades. Additionally, consider diversifying your portfolio to spread risk across different assets. It's also wise to allocate only a small percentage of your total capital to any single trade. This approach helps protect your investment and ensures you can continue trading even after experiencing losses.

Utilizing Leverage Wisely

Leverage can amplify both your gains and losses in Kraken Futures trading. While it can be tempting to use high leverage to increase potential profits, it's important to use it wisely. Start with lower leverage levels until you gain more experience and confidence in your trading strategy. Understand the implications of margin calls and ensure you have sufficient funds in your account to cover potential losses. Using leverage responsibly can help you manage risk and achieve more consistent results.

Technical Analysis

Technical analysis is a valuable tool for Kraken Futures traders. It involves studying price charts and using various indicators to predict future price movements. Some popular technical indicators include moving averages, Relative Strength Index (RSI), and Bollinger Bands. By analyzing these indicators, you can identify potential entry and exit points for your trades. It's important to combine technical analysis with other forms of analysis, such as fundamental analysis, to make well-rounded trading decisions.

Fundamental Analysis

In addition to technical analysis, fundamental analysis plays a crucial role in Kraken Futures trading. This involves evaluating the underlying factors that can influence cryptocurrency prices, such as project developments, regulatory news, and macroeconomic trends. Stay informed about the latest news and developments in the cryptocurrency space. For example, announcements from major cryptocurrency projects or changes in regulatory policies can significantly impact market sentiment and prices. Incorporating fundamental analysis into your trading strategy can help you make more informed decisions.

Backtesting and Demo Trading

Before risking real money on Kraken Futures, it's beneficial to backtest your trading strategies and practice with demo trading. Backtesting involves applying your trading strategy to historical data to see how it would have performed. This can help you identify potential flaws and refine your approach. Demo trading allows you to practice trading in a simulated environment without financial risk. Use these tools to gain confidence in your strategies and understand how they perform under different market conditions. Backtesting and demo trading are essential steps in preparing for live trading on Kraken Futures.

Common Questions About Kraken Futures Trading

Q: What are the different types of futures contracts available on Kraken?

A: Kraken offers two main types of futures contracts: perpetual futures and quarterly futures. Perpetual futures do not have an expiration date and are designed to closely track the underlying asset's price. Quarterly futures, on the other hand, have a set expiration date and are settled at the end of each quarter.
